titleOfInvention Method and applicator for detecting cleaning and/or disinfection of surfaces or objects
abstract The invention relates to a method for detecting cleaning and/or disinfection of surfaces or objects in areas where a certain degree of purity has to be guaranteed, especially in health care facilities, the pharmaceutical industry and for producing medicine products. The inventive method is characterised in that applicators are applied to the surfaces or objects to be cleaned and/or disinfected and in the surface area where cleaning and/or disinfection is effective, whereby said applicators are applied before cleaning and/or disinfection. The applicators consist of a flat carrier respectively which has to be detachably connected to the surface or object with the rear side thereof, whereby said surface or object has to be verified. The carrier is coated with a test contamination on the front side thereof. Said coating is applied to all the carriers of a series with repeating accuracy and in such a way that incomplete cleaning and/or incomplete disinfection results in a partial cleaning process and/or partial disinfection process of the test contamination and that said partial cleaning process and/or partial disinfection process is evaluated and interpreted according to a downstream evaluation method in such a way that a constant and real-valued quality coefficient is allocated to a partial cleaning process and/or partial disinfection process respectively. Said coefficient clearly quantifies the extent of the partial cleaning process and/or partial disinfection process.
